Transaction 69c594616c15a1bf656181448a25a3385c560f1e34a2b08a2425df5ea4657f99

1 Input
2 Outputs
  • 69c594616c15a1bf656181448a25a3385c560f1e34a2b08a2425df5ea4657f99:0
  • value  55434
    address  18rdKmjrg1EawxgiVT3ikLExj6GWS2MNCk
  • 69c594616c15a1bf656181448a25a3385c560f1e34a2b08a2425df5ea4657f99:1
  • value  580406
    address  396J75eWrTwSBMH6Fj32tbYxUuX4oQfEzJ